0% encontró este documento útil (0 votos)
38 vistas16 páginas

Interpolación de Newton Simplificada

Cargado por

Milagros Santana
Derechos de autor
© © All Rights Reserved
Nos tomamos en serio los derechos de los contenidos. Si sospechas que se trata de tu contenido, reclámalo aquí.
Formatos disponibles
Descarga como PPTX, PDF, TXT o lee en línea desde Scribd
0% encontró este documento útil (0 votos)
38 vistas16 páginas

Interpolación de Newton Simplificada

Cargado por

Milagros Santana
Derechos de autor
© © All Rights Reserved
Nos tomamos en serio los derechos de los contenidos. Si sospechas que se trata de tu contenido, reclámalo aquí.
Formatos disponibles
Descarga como PPTX, PDF, TXT o lee en línea desde Scribd

INTERPOLACIÓN POLINÓMICA

DE NEWTON EN DIFERENCIAS DIVIDIDAS


Interpolación Polinómica de Newton
en Diferencias Divididas
Con frecuencia se encontrará que se tiene que estimar
valores intermedios entre datos definidos por puntos.
El método más común es la Interpolación Polinomial
de Newton en Diferencia Divididas. Para un
polinomio de n-enésimo grado.

(ec. 1)
Interpolación Polinómica de Newton
en Diferencias Divididas
Dados n+1 puntos , existe uno y solo un polinomio
de grado n que pasa por todos los puntos.

Ejemplos de Interpolación Polinomial:


(a) De primer grado (lineal) que une dos puntos.
(b) de segundo grado (cuadrática o parabólica) que une tres puntos.
(c) De tercer grado (cúbica) que une cuatro puntos
Interpolación Polinómica de Newton
en Diferencias Divididas
 Interpolación Lineal: forma más simple de interpolación que consiste
en unir dos puntos es mediante una línea recta.

𝑓 1 ( 𝑥 ) − 𝑓 ( 𝑥 0 ) 𝑓 ( 𝑥 1) − 𝑓 ( 𝑥 0 )
=
𝑥 − 𝑥0 𝑥1 − 𝑥0

𝑓 ( 𝑥 1) − 𝑓 ( 𝑥 0 )
𝑓 1 ( 𝑥 )= 𝑓 ( 𝑥 0 ) + ( )
𝑥 − 𝑥 0ec.2
𝑥1− 𝑥0

La notación designa que este es un polinomio de interpolación de


primer grado.
Representa la pendiente de la línea que une los puntos. Es una
aproximación en diferencia dividida finita a la primera derivada
Interpolación Polinómica de Newton
en Diferencias Divididas
 Interpolación Cuadrática: Si se tienen tres puntos como datos, estos pueden
ajustarse en un polinomio de segundo grado. La forma general queda
expresada:
 ec.3
 Esta ecuación es similar a la primera

 Agrupando términos:

 Donde
Interpolación Polinómica de Newton
en Diferencias Divididas
 Interpolación Cuadrática:
Para encontrar los valores de los coeficientes se evalúa en la
ecuación (3) en su orden , , para obtener:

ec.4

ec.5

ec.6
Interpolación Polinómica de Newton
en Diferencias Divididas
 Forma general de los polinomios de interpolación de Newton:
Se puede generalizar para ajustar a un polinomio de n-enésimo grado a n+1
datos:
ec.7
Para un polinomio de n-enésimo grado se requieren n + 1 puntos.
Los coeficientes resultantes serán:

ec.8
 .
ec.9
ec.10
 .
ec.11
Interpolación Polinómica de Newton
en Diferencias Divididas
 Forma general de los polinomios de interpolación de Newton:
Donde la evaluaciones de la función colocadas entre paréntesis son
diferencias divididas finitas. La primera diferencia dividida finita se
representa por:

ec.12
La segunda diferencia dividida finita , que representa la diferencia de las dos
primeras diferencias divididas, se expresa

ec.13
Interpolación Polinómica de Newton
en Diferencias Divididas
 Forma general de los polinomios de interpolación de Newton:
En forma similar, la enésima diferencia dividida es
ec.14
Estas diferencias sirven para evaluar los coeficientes en las ecuaciones (ec.8) a
(ec.11), los cuales se sustituirán en la ecuación (ec.7) para obtener el polinomio
de interpolación de Newton en diferencias divididas

ec.15

Representación gráfica de la naturaleza recursiva de las diferencias divididas


finitas.

Problema
1_ Dado los datos:
x 1 2 3 3.5 5 6
f(x) 1 5 7.5 8 5 1 𝑏 4= 𝑓 ( 𝑥 5 , 𝑥 4 , 𝑥 3 , 𝑥 2 , 𝑥1 , 𝑥 0 )
Calcule f(3.4) mediante polinomio de interpolación de Newton de orden 2 a 4. Escoja la
secuencia de puntos para su estimación con el fin de obtener la mejor exactitud posible.
Construya en papel milimetrado la gráfica correspondiente a los datos y la curva de cada
polinomio obtenido. Emplee colores diferentes para cada una.
i x f(x) Primero Segundo tercero cuarto quinto
0 1 1 𝑓 ( 𝑥1 ) − 𝑓 ( 𝑥 0 ) 𝑓 ( 𝑥 2 ) − 𝑓 ( 𝑥1 ) − 𝑓 ( 𝑥 1 ) − 𝑓 ( 𝑥 0 )𝑏 = 𝑓 𝑥 , 𝑥 , 𝑥 ,𝑏𝑥5 = , 𝑥0 )( 5 4 3 2 1
𝑓 𝑥 , 𝑥 ,𝑥 ,𝑥 ,𝑥 , 𝑥
1 2 5 𝟒 −𝟎. 𝟕𝟓 −𝟎 . 𝟏 −𝟎.𝟎𝟏𝟔𝟔𝟔𝟔𝟔
𝑏1 = 𝑓 ( 𝑥 1 , 𝑥 0 )=
𝑏 2= 𝑓 ( 𝑥 𝑥 2 , 1𝑥 −1 ,𝑥𝑥00 ) = 𝑓 ( 𝑥 ) − 𝑓 1( 𝑥3 ) (𝑓 (3𝑥 1) −
𝑥 2 − 𝑥𝑏 = 𝑓 𝑥 ,
𝑥 𝑥 −
𝑥2 2 − 𝑥0 2 𝑓 ( 𝑥 1 )
,
2 01𝑥
𝑥 , 𝑥 0)
4 ( 4 3 2 1

−𝟏 −𝟎.𝟏𝟔𝟔𝟔𝟔𝟕𝟎 . 𝟏 𝑏 4= 𝑓 ( 𝑥 5 , 𝑥 4 , 𝑥 3 , 𝑥 2 , 𝑥1 )
3
𝑓 ( 𝑥 2 ) − 𝑓 ( 𝑥1 ) −
𝑏1 = 𝑓 ( 𝑥 2 , 2
𝑥𝑏1 ) =
= 𝑓 ( 𝑥 , 𝑥 , 𝑥 )= 𝑥 3 − 𝑥𝑏 2 =𝑓 𝑥 𝑥
( , 2 −,𝑥
𝑥 𝑥 1 ,𝑥
1)
2 3 7.5 2 𝑥3 2 −2𝑥1 1 3
𝑥 − 𝑥
4 3 2
𝑓 ( 𝑥3 ) − 𝑓 ( 𝑥 2 ) 𝑓 ( 𝑥 ) − 𝑓 ( 𝑥 ) 𝑓 ( 𝑥 ) − 𝑓 ( 𝑥 2)

𝟏 . 𝟎 −𝟏 . 𝟓
4 33 3 3
𝑏1 = 𝑓 ( 𝑥 3 , 𝑥 2 )= −
𝑥 − 𝑥𝑏 = 𝑓 ( 𝑥 5 ,𝑥𝑥3 4−, 𝑥 𝑥23 , 𝑥 2 )
𝑏 2= 𝑓 ( 𝑥𝑥43,− 𝑥 3𝑥,2𝑥 2 ) = 𝑓 𝑥 4 − 𝑓 3 3𝑥
3 3.5 8 ( 5) ( 𝑥4 4) − 𝑥𝑓 2( 𝑥 4 ) − 𝑓 ( 𝑥 3 )
−𝟐 −𝟎 . 𝟖
𝑏1 = 𝑓 ( 𝑥 4 , 𝑥 𝑏
3 )= = 𝑓
𝑓 ( 𝑥4) − 𝑓 ( 𝑥3)
( 𝑥𝑥 , 𝑥
5 −4𝑥 3 , 𝑥 ) =
𝑥5− 𝑥4

𝑥4 − 𝑥3
4 5 5 2
4 3
𝑓 ( 𝑥5 ) − 𝑓 ( 𝑥 4 ) 𝑥5− 𝑥3
−𝟒
𝑏1 = 𝑓 ( 𝑥 5 , 𝑥 4 )=
𝑥5− 𝑥4
5 6 1
Continuación del problema

Polinomios generados de :

Segundo orden:

f2(x) = f(x0) +f[x1x0](x-x0) + f[x2x1x0](x-x0)(x-x1)

f2(x) = 1 + 4(x - 1) - 0.75(x- 1)(x - 2)

f2(3.4) = 1 + 4(3.4 - 1) - 0.75(3.4 - 1)(3.4 - 2) = 8.08

Tercer orden:

f3(x) = f(x0) +f[x1x0](x-x0) + f[x2x1x0](x-x0)(x-x1) + f[x3x2x1x0](x-x0)(x-x1)(x-x2)

f3(x) = 1 + 4(x - 1) - 0.75(x - 1)(x - 2) - 0.1(x - 1)(x – 2)(x - 3)

f3(3.4) = 1 + 4(3.4 - 1) - 0.75(3.4 - 1)(3.4 - 2) - 0.1(3.4 - 1)(3.4 – 2)(3.4 - 3) = 7.9456

Cuarto orden:

f4(x) = f(x0) +f[x1x0](x-x0) + f[x2x1x0](x-x0)(x-x1) + f[x3x2x1x0](x-x0)(x-x1)(x-x2) + f[x4x3x2x1x0](x-x0)(x-x1)(x-x2)(x-x3)

f4(x) = 1 + 4(x - 1) - 0.75(x- 1)(x - 2) - 0.1(x - 1)(x – 2)(x - 3) - 0.01666666(x - 1)(x – 2)(x - 3)(x - 3.5)

f4(3.4) = 1 + 4(3.4 - 1) - 0.75(3.4- 1)(3.4 - 2) - 0.1(3.4 - 1)(3.4 – 2)(3.4 - 3)

- 0.01666666(3.4 - 1)(3.4 – 2)(3.4 - 3)(3.4 - 3.5) = 7.94784


Quinto orden:
f5(x) = f(x0) +f[x1x0](x-x0) + f[x2x1x0](x-x0)(x-x1) + f[x3x2x1x0](x-x0)(x-x1)(x-x2) + f[x4x3x2x1x0](x-x0)(x-x1)(x-x2)(x-x3) +
f[x5x4x3x2x1x0](x-x0)(x-x1)(x-x2)(x-x3)(x-x4)

f5(x) = 1 + 4(x- 1) - 0.75(x - 1)(x - 2) - 0.1(x - 1)(x – 2)(x - 3) - 0.0166666(3.4 - 1)(3.4 – 2)(3.4 - 3)(3.4 - 3.5) +
0.02333333(3.4 - 1)(3.4 – 2)(3.4 - 3)(3.4 - 3.5)(3.4 - 5)

f5(3.4) = 1 + 4(3.4 - 1) - 0.75(3.4 - 1)(3.4 - 2) - 0.1(3.4 - 1)(3.4 – 2)(3.4 - 3)- 0.0166666(3.4 - 1)(3.4 – 2)(3.4 - 3)(3.4 - 3.5) +
0.02333333(3.4 - 1)(3.4 – 2)(3.4 - 3)(3.4 - 3.5)(3.4 - 5)
= 7.9528576
Interpolación Polinómica de Newton
en Diferencias Divididas
Datos ajustados a un polinomio de Segundo orden ( 3 primeros puntos)
f2(x) = 1 +4(x-1) -0.75(x-1)(x-2)
10
Datos
9 Polinomio segundo orden
Estimación 2do orden f(3.4) = 8.08
8

3
f(x)

-1

-2

-3

-4

-5
0 0.5 1 1.5 2 2.5 3 3.4
3.5 4 4.5 5 5.5 6 6.5 7
x
Interpolación Polinómica de Newton
en Diferencias Divididas
Datos ajustados a un polinomio de Tercer orden ( 4 primeros puntos)
f3(x) = 1 + 4(x-1) - 0.75(x-1)(x-2) - 0.1(x-1)(x-2)(x-3)
10

9
Datos
8 Polinomio tercer orden
Estimación 3er orden f(3.4) = 7.9456
7

3
f(x)

-1

-2

-3

-4

-5 3.4
0 0.5 1 1.5 2 2.5 3 3.5 4 4.5 5 5.5 6 6.5 7
x
Interpolación Polinómica de Newton
en Diferencias Divididas
Datos ajustados a un polinomio de cuarto orden ( 5 primeros puntos)
f4(x) = 1 + 4(x-1) - 0.75(x-1)(x-2) - 0.1(x-1)(x-2)(x-3) - 0.01666666(x-1)(x-2)(x-3)(x-3.5)
10
9
Datos
8 Polinomio cuarto orden
7 Estimación 4to orden f(3.4) = 7.94784
6
5
4
3
2
1
f(x)

0
-1
-2
-3
-4
-5
-6
-7
-8
-9
-10 3.4
0 0.5 1 1.5 2 2.5 3 3.5 4 4.5 5 5.5 6 6.5 7
x
Interpolación Polinómica de Newton
en Diferencias Divididas
Datos ajustados con polinomios de segundo, tercero, cuarto y quinto
orden
10

2
f(x)

-2 Datos
Polinomio segundo orden
polinomio tercer orden
-4 polinomio cuarto orden
polinomio quinto orden
Estimación 2do f(3.4) = 8.08
-6 Estimacion 3er f(3.4) = 7.9456
Estimación 4to f(3.4) = 7.94784
Estimación 5to f(3.4) = 7.9528576
-8

-10
3.4
0 0.5 1 1.5 2 2.5 3 3.5 4 4.5 5 5.5 6 6.5 7
x

También podría gustarte